Co to jest Bootstrap?

Jest tu wiele pytań związanych z Bootstrap. Widzę, że wielu ludzi go używa. Więc próbowałem go zbadać i znalazłem oficjalną stronę Bootstrap, ale była tylko sekcja pobierania i kilka słów później. Nic, co by wyjaśniało, po co to jest... Po prostu zrozumiałem, że jest to Pomocnik front-end. Próbowałem znaleźć coś przez Googling, ale nie znalazłem nic konkretnego. Wszystko, co znalazłem, jest związane z definicją informatyki.

Moje pytania są:

  • czym w ogóle jest Bootstrap?
  • do czego służy i jak pomaga w rozwoju front-endu?
  • Chciałbym również wyjaśnić więcej szczegółów.
Author: Filipp W., 2013-01-27

5 answers

Jest to otwarty Framework HTML, CSS, javascript (pierwotnie stworzony przez Twittera), który można wykorzystać jako podstawę do tworzenia stron internetowych lub aplikacji internetowych.

Update

Na Oficjalna strona boostrap jest aktualizowany i zawiera jasną definicję.

" Bootstrap to najpopularniejszy Framework HTML, CSS i JS do tworzenia responsywnych, mobilnych projektów w Internecie."

[[0]}"zaprojektowany i zbudowany z całą miłością na świecie przez @mdo i @fat ."
 255
Author: hutchonoid,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-09-17 09:47:50

Bootstrap jest open-source Javascript framework opracowany przez zespół w Twitter. Jest to kombinacja kodu HTML, CSS i Javascript zaprojektowana, aby pomóc w budowaniu komponentów interfejsu użytkownika. Bootstrap został również zaprogramowany do obsługi zarówno HTML5, jak i CSS3.

Również nazywa się Front-end-framework.

Bootstrap to darmowy zbiór narzędzi do tworzenia stron internetowych i aplikacji internetowych.

Zawiera szablony projektowe oparte na HTML i CSS dla typografia, formularze, przyciski, nawigacja i inne komponenty interfejsu, a także opcjonalne rozszerzenia JavaScript.

Niektóre powody, dla których programiści preferowali Framework Bootstrap

  1. Łatwe rozpoczęcie

  2. Great grid system

  3. Podstawy stylizacji dla większości HTML elementy (Typografia,Kod,tabele,formularze,przyciski,obrazy, ikony)

  4. Obszerna lista komponentów

  5. Pakiet Javascript Wtyczki

Zaczerpnięte z About Bootstrap Framework

 90
Author: GowriShankar,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-09-20 14:56:19

Bootstrap, jak Wiem, jest dobrze zdefiniowanym CSS. Chociaż za pomocą Bootstrap można również użyć JavaScript, jQuery itp. Ale główna różnica polega na tym, że używając Bootstrap możesz po prostu wywołać nazwę klasy, a następnie uzyskać wynik w formularzu HTML. dla np. kolorowanie przycisków kształtowanie tekstu za pomocą układów. Do tego wszystkiego nie musisz pisać pliku CSS, a po prostu musisz użyć poprawnej nazwy klasy do kształtowania formularza HTML.

 22
Author: Blitz,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2017-02-28 02:15:14

W prostszych słowach można zrozumieć Bootstrap jako front-end web framework, który został stworzony przez Twitter do szybszego tworzenia aplikacji internetowych reagujących na urządzenia. Bootstrap może być również rozumiany głównie jako zbiór zdefiniowanych w nim klas CSS, które mogą być po prostu używane bezpośrednio. Wykorzystuje CSS, javascript, jQuery itp. w tle, aby utworzyć styl, efekty i akcje dla elementów Bootstrap.

Możesz wiedzieć, że używamy CSS do stylizacji elementów strony internetowej Tworzenie klas i przypisywanie klas do elementów strony internetowej, aby zastosować do nich styl. Bootstrap tutaj ułatwia projektowanie, ponieważ musimy tylko dołączyć pliki Bootstrap i wspomnieć o predefiniowanych nazwach klas Bootstrap dla naszych elementów strony internetowej i będą one stylizowane automatycznie przez Bootstrap. Dzięki temu pozbędziemy się pisania własnych klas CSS do stylizacji elementów strony internetowej. Co najważniejsze Bootstrap jest zaprojektowany w taki sposób, aby Twoje urządzenie internetowe było responsywne i to jest głównym jego celem. Innymi alternatywami dla Bootstrap może być - Fundacja, zmaterializować itd. ramy.

Bootstrap sprawia, że nie piszesz dużo kodu CSS, a także oszczędza twój czas, który poświęcasz na projektowanie stron internetowych.

 19
Author: gauravparmar,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2018-03-12 06:01:38

Bootstrap jest open-source CSS, JavaScript framework, który został pierwotnie opracowany dla aplikacji twitter przez zespół projektantów i programistów Twittera. Potem wydali go na open-source. Będąc wieloletnim użytkownikiem Twittera bootstrap uważam, że jest to jeden z najlepszych do projektowania mobilnych responsywnych stron internetowych. Wiele wtyczek CSS i Javascript jest dostępnych do projektowania Twojej strony internetowej w mgnieniu oka. To rodzaj szybkiego projektu szablonu. Niektórzy narzekają, że Bootstrap CSS pliki są ciężkie i wymagają czasu, aby załadować, ale te roszczenia są wykonane przez leniwych ludzi. Nie musisz trzymać całego Bootstrapa.css w Twojej witrynie. Zawsze masz możliwość usunięcia stylów komponentów, których nie potrzebujesz w swojej witrynie. Na przykład, jeśli używasz tylko podstawowych komponentów, takich jak formularze i przyciski, możesz usunąć inne komponenty, takie jak akordeony itp.z głównego pliku CSS. Aby rozpocząć zabawę w bootstrap możesz pobrać podstawowe szablony i komponenty z getbootstrap site and let the magic happen.

 16
Author: valueweaver,
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2017-02-23 11:20:28